Bethanie has dedicated her volunteer efforts to a number of organizations in her community including the St. Michael’s Centre where she does manicures for seniors and Collingwood Neighbourhood House where she is an assistant instructor coaching gymnastics. She also volunteers at the Chinese Grace Mennonite Church as a Children’s Ministries Leader and a Summer Day Camp Leader. At school Bethanie is the Chair of both the Bottle Recycling Club and the Global Action Against Poverty Club. She participates with Best Buddies and Mind Over Autism, mentors new students, and helps coach the girls volleyball team. Athletically Bethanie has played both Volleyball and Softball.
Bethanie will be pursuing a Bachelor of Science Degree at the University of British Columbia.
